Rowing Produces Strong Weekend at the Knecht Cup

Knecht Cup Women

Women's Rowing | April 10, 2022

CHERRY HILL, N.J. – The La Salle rowing team completed a successful day on the water in the Knecht Cup on Saturday and Sunday, totaling two gold medals and seven finals over the course of the two days.
 
The men continued the strong start to the spring season, tallying gold medals in the varsity 4+ and the freshman 4+.
 
"Another historical achievement this weekend," said assistant coach Ivo Krakic. "It has been 20 years since La Salle won at Knecht cup. This time we did it twice. Additionally, we medaled in every category we entered! The guys showed an amazing effort and will continue to get faster!"
 
Starting Sunday out was the Men's Lightweight 4+, crossing the line in third place after MIT and Iona with a time of 7:04.88, 10 seconds off of a first place finish.
 
After winning their qualifying heat on Saturday, the Men's Frosh 4+ followed suit again on Sunday, dominating in a 27 second victory over the field in the grand finals with a finish 6:42.53.
 
In a smaller field, the Men's Second Varsity 4+ placed second, falling just behind Big 10 foe Michigan with a time of 7:11.58.
 
The Men's Varsity 4+ finished the day off on a high for the men's squad, placing first out of 16 teams to secure a five second advantage over second place Mercyhurst with a finish of 6:39.19.
 
On the women's side, the Women's Varsity 4+ secured a spot in qualifying to the petite finals on Saturday in their debut race of the season, finishing fourth in their heat and just a bow ball behind Merrimack. The Explorers crossed the finish line in 8:30.94, surpassing Merrimack by seven seconds to kick off the final day of races off for the women.
 
Also qualifying to the petite final was the Women's Second Varsity 8+ after finishing fifth in a tight heat. The women placed bronze in the late morning race with a time of 7:16.53, only 4.3 seconds separating the top three boats. The time proved significantly quicker than their first run, cutting the deficit behind Harvard from seven to two seconds in the petite final, while extending their advantage over Colgate from three seconds to 18 seconds.
 
The Women's Varsity 8+ competed in three different levels of races this weekend, opening with a fourth place finish in the opening heat. In the semis, the boat held onto the rest of the pack and used a surging final five strokes to place fourth in their heat and advance to the petite finals, sprinting ahead of Barry towards the end. The boat once again improved in the finals, cutting the gap to leaders Stetson and Delaware to just finish third by less than four seconds.
 
"Our goal this weekend was to use every opportunity to get significantly faster, and I can proudly say all three crews improved from heats to finals, and each had their best races of the season in their finals," said assistant coach Kelsey Franks. "They were technically sharp in choppy conditions, extremely powerful through the water, and raced with so much heart. I've never worked with a more adept group of women - every time they race, these crews just get faster and more dangerous to their competitors. I'm especially proud of being the highest-finishing Atlantic 10 Varsity 8+ at Knecht Cup. That result isn't because of one boat's performance, that's from the entire team pushing those 9 women to their limit every single day."
